Joint dialog act segmentation and recognition in human conversations using attention to dialog context

机译:通过关注对话上下文来在人类对话中联合对话行为分割和识别

获取原文
获取原文并翻译 | 示例
       

摘要

A dialog act represents the communicative function of an utterance in a conversation, and thus provides informative cues for understanding, managing, and generating dialog. While most spoken dialog systems process user input and system output at the turn level, a single turn can consist of multiple dialog acts in human conversations. Therefore, segmenting turn-level tokens into a meaningful dialog act unit is just as important as recognizing the dialog act. Towards joint segmentation and recognition of dialog acts, we propose an encoder-decoder model featuring joint coding and incorporate contextual information by means of an attentional mechanism. The proposed encoder-decoder outperforms other models in segmentation, and the application of attentions significantly reduces recognition error rates. By combining the encoder-decoder model with contextual attention, we achieve state-of-the-art performance in the joint evaluation of dialog act segmentation and recognition. (C) 2019 Elsevier Ltd.
